Well, we saw this one coming. In a sneak peek for the new episode of 'Empire,' Cookie and Malcolm's chemistry finally gets tested out--and it's very steamy! Lucious (Terrence Howard) better not find out about this! On the Mar. 11 episode of Empire, it seems like Cookie (Taraji P. Henson) is finally getting what she wants out of her crush on her ex-husband's security guard, Malcolm (Derek Luke). In this sneak peak, we see the two of them totally make out behind Lucious' back-- certainly nothing can go badly with that right?

After we saw Cookie literally spread her legs in an attempt to seduce Malcolm on Empire, it seems like the young security guard is finally falling prey to Cookie’s predator.

“May I have a word?” Malcolm asks after knocking on the door to Cookie’s office. We already smell ulterior motives.

“Did I violate some top secret, super classified security code?” Cookie asks him with a raised brow. And yes, she’s clearly flirting.

Malcolm corrects her, though, saying that he is actually the one who’s violated the code–his own personal code of conduct. “I’ve been disloyal to my commander, by falling for his wife.”

Falling for who now?

‘Are You Saying You’re Falling For Me?’

With this revelation finally out in the open, Malcolm explains to Cookie that he will need to be keeping his distance from her. But just as he steps out to leave, Cookie gets up from the desk to stop him.

“Are you saying you’re falling for me?” she asks, very obviously intrigued, and very obviously not upset. He apologizes to her, then turns around to once again try and walk out. Nice try!

“Malcolm,” she says, walking towards him. She looks him deep in the eyes for a couple seconds– and then she totally starts making out with him! And guess what? He kisses her back. I mean, duh.
